Long-term monitoring of comet 67P/Churyumov-Gerasimenko's jets with OSIRIS onboard Rosetta
Jorda, L.; Lamy, P. L.; Lara, L. M. +47 more
We used the OSIRIS camera system onboard the Rosetta spacecraft to monitor jet activity of comet 67P/Churyumov-Gerasimenko. With a monthly cadence, we covered an epoch from 2014 December to 2015 October, thereby including the first equinox and the perihelion passage. On the east-west longitudinally asymmetric distribution of solar proton events
Wan, W.; He, H. -Q.
A large data set of 78 solar proton events observed near the Earth's orbit during 1996-2011 is investigated. An east-west longitudinal (azimuthal) asymmetry is found to exist in the distribution of flare sources of solar proton events. Mid-infrared observations of O-type stars: spectral morphology
Bouret, J. -C.; Audard, M.; Lanz, T. +2 more
We present mid-infrared (mid-IR) observations for a sample of 16 O-type stars. The data were acquired with the NASA Spitzer Space Telescope, using the IRS instrument at moderate resolution (R ∼ 600), covering the range of ∼10-37 µm.
